  • Patent number: 9540780
    Abstract: A pot bearing is provided for absorbing rotations with little constraint, comprising a pot, an elastomer cushion accommodated therein and a cover projecting at least partially into the pot and supported on said cushion. The elastomer cushion is slidingly sealed off from the pot, around the edge beneath the cover by means of a circumferential inner seal, which consists entirely or at least primarily of acetal with a melt flow index (MFI 190/2.16) of less than 6 g/10 min.

  • Patent number: 9540774
    Abstract: An expansion joint bridging device which bridges an expansion joint between two construction work parts of a traversable construction work. The expansion joint is spanned by at least two crossbeams which are supported in a load-bearing manner on both construction work parts, wherein at least one of the load-bearing supports allows a displacement movement. An overload safety device comprises two supporting profiles at a distance from one another and supported on the crossbeams, and a fill profile bridging the gap between the support profiles. If a threshold value for the force that would effect the two support profiles to approach one another is exceeded, a fixing device releases the positional stabilization such that the two support profiles can be moved towards one another by displacing the fill profile upwards out of the gap.

  • Publication number: 20070196171
    Abstract: A bridging device for an expansion joint, the expansion joint being placed between an abutment and a superstructure, comprises at least one plate that extends longitudinally of the joint, and is placed between the abutment and the superstructure, and which is supported on at least two traverses that span the expansion joint while resting upon the abutment and the superstructure. A tooth profile is placed on the top side of the plate and the teeth thereof, which point toward both sides, mesh with the teeth of teeth profiles assigned to the adjacent plates or edge profiles. Two sealing strips are connected to each plate and are detachably connected to the adjacent plate(s) or to the adjacent edge profile(s). Both sealing strips connected to the relevant plate are, in the area of the parting plane, fixed between the at least one plate and the tooth profile placed thereon.
